The “Tank of Shark” lung tank, Barbara Corcoran, 76, announced last week she was putting her beloved attic in New York City in the market for $ 12 million, and the apartment almost immediately found a buyer.

According to the last report of the Luxury Market of Olshan, Corcoran’s duplex penthouse in 1158 Fifth had multiple bidders and was sold for the sale price within 24 hours after the list. The final price paid by the unit and the identity of the new owner is still unknown, but it will be revealed as soon as the agreement is closed.

The property was one of the 36 contracts signed last week in Manhattan with a value of $ 4 million or more, according to Olshan’s report.

“Real estate are always emotional, but I never thought about saying goodbye to this beautiful palace in heaven,” Corcoran wrote on Instagram last week. “I just hope that the special person who bought it appreciates it as much as I!”

The 4,600 square feet cooperative and 11 rooms have four bedrooms, four full bathrooms and two bathrooms. Monthly maintenance rates are $ 11,693.32. Corcoran listed the property with Corcoran Group, the real estate firm that he founded in 1973 and sold in 2001 for $ 66 million.

Corcoran saw the attic for the first time in 1992, when he was delivering letters for a messaging service such as a side hustle. The terrace of the apartment was impressed with views of Central Park, and asked the then owner of the house to call if they ever thought of the unit.

More than two decades passed without a phone call. Finally, in 2015, the owner was ready to sell. Corcoran bought the property for $ 10 million and spent additional $ 2 million in renovations, designing the house exactly as he imagined. He added a library with a fireplace, a complete kitchen next to the terrace and a butler pantry.

Corcoran is moving from the duplex penthouse and towards a single floor to save her and her husband, Bill Higgins, 80, the trip up and down the stairs. The duo has already found a single -floor apartment in the same Carnegie Hill neighborhood.

Corcoran previously revealed that he earns $ 300,000 as an investor of “Shark Tank”, but Usuary invests about $ 1 million per year in new companies that come in the program. He also declared that he earns $ 4.5 million annually of his shares, bonds and other investments.

Corcoran has been in “Shark Tank” for 16 years and has closed 650 agreements in the program.
